* Real Estate Technology
In order for a technology course to be approved for real estate continuing education in Montana, the course must (1) be taught by a Montana approved instructor, (2) be beneficial to, and in some aspect, protective of consumers - buyers or sellers - and, (3) address one of the topics approved by the Board for continuing education rather than just demonstrate the mechanics of how the technology functions.
Clearly, there are some basic technology skills that are necessary in today's world in order to practice real estate in the way that consumers expect and require. In recognition of this need, the Board may choose to approve technology courses that provide the attendee with those necessary skills. Most courses will not be approved for hour-for-hour credit. Examples of such courses:
- Basic and advanced E-mail
- Creating and sending pdf files
- Creating and sending photo images
- Electronic signatures
- Website requirements
- Sending documents on-line
- Technology advances
In no case, however, will the Board approve a course whose primary function is to teach the licensee how to enhance or expand their real estate business through client contact, prospecting, self-promotion, etc. Courses which require the use of a particular brand of software in order for the instruction to be effective, or use software that must be purchased by the licnesee will not be approved.
